Heads and headers

How hard it is to install L98 Alum heads and a set of hedman tubular exhaust system headers with the engine in the car.....

Its not all that hard, just very time consuming. Youll need to pull the whole intake off, as well as all of the accessory brackets. The headders are the easy part, only takes a few hours. I would start by taking out the stock manifolds and y pipe, then the entire intake, then all of the accessory brackets. Once all of that is off, youll need to unbolt the heads, which isnt really a problem. If your goin down that far, why not pull the water pump and radiator and put a cam in there too? Its only a few more hours work.
